COVID-19: Record high 4,275 cases today, over 2,000 reported in the Klang Valley

Malaysia has recorded 4,275 new COVID-19 cases today which brings the total number of infections to 180,455. There are 7 new deaths reported and the death toll is now 667.

The Ministry of Health has reported 4,313 new recoveries and a total of 137,019 patients have recovered and discharged so far. Today Malaysia has set two new records – the highest number of new COVID-19 cases and new recoveries in a single day. The recovery rate is now 75.9% while the mortality rate is 0.4%.

There are currently 42,769 active cases remaining which are receiving treatment. 260 are in ICU while 103 require respiratory support.

Out of the 4,275 new cases today, 11 are imported while 4,264 are transmitted locally. Selangor recorded the most with 1,421 cases, followed by Kuala Lumpur with 548 cases, Sabah with 498 cases and Johor with 425 cases.

The Ministry of Health has identified 11 new clusters and 8 are workplace related. Below is the full list of new clusters:

A total of 84 active clusters have recorded new COVID-19 cases today. The newly identified Bali Residence construction site cluster in Melaka reported the most with 203 cases, followed by Pasar cluster with 132 cases and Beringin cluster with 74 cases.
